General Education Requirements

You must have completed these courses with a "C" or better. Be sure to indicate any courses listed below that you plan to be enrolled in during the Spring 2026 term. You may not receive points for courses you do not disclose on this application.

Anatomy & Physiology I, BIO 211 (BIO 103 OR BIO 111 are pre- or co-requisites for BIO 211):

Anatomy & Physiology II, BIO 212

English Composition, ENG 101

General Psychology, PSC 150

Human Growth and Development, PSC 250

College Algebra, MATH 113

Arts/Humanities Elective (Gen Ed Requirement from catalog)

Note:

Licensing boards for certain health care occupations, including PTA, may deny, suspend, or revoke a license or may deny the individual the opportunity to sit for an examination even if the individual has completed all program course work, if it is determined that an applicant has a criminal history or is convicted or pleads guilty or nolo contendere to a felony or other serious crime. If applicable, it is recommended to contact the Maryland Board of Physical Therapy for clarification at 410-764-4752.
